This delicious Creamy French Apple Tart is one dessert that is guaranteed to impress your guests! For a gluten-free twist, eliminate the graham cracker crust and simply place the filling in ramekins or a small bowl. We love serving this dessert topped with Disaronno or Amaretto to enhance the almond flavor!

Prep Time | 30 minutes |
Cook Time | 35 minutes |

Ingredients
Graham Cracker Crust:
- 1 & 1/4 cups graham cracker crumbs
- 1/4 cup butter , melted (non-salted)
Main Ingredients:
- 3 cups apples , peeled and sliced thin
- 3 eggs
- 1/4 teaspoon pure almond extract
- 1/2 cup coconut palm sugar
- 1 cup butter , melted (non-salted)
- 4 ounces cream cheese (cubed and softened)
- 1 cup oat flour
- 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on

Instructions
Graham Cracker Crust:
- If you're making a gluten-free dessert, skip the graham cracker crust steps and move straight to the main ingredients.
- Mix graham crumbs and 1/4 cup melted butter until well blended. Press firmly onto bottom and up the sides of 10-inch springform pan.
Main Ingredients:
- Arrange apple slices in a circular overlapping pattern on graham crumbs.
- In a bowl, beat eggs, almond extract, sugar, melted butter, cream cheese and flour until blended. Spread over apples and sprinkle with cinnamon.
- Bake at 350 degrees for 35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ted near center comes out clean. Cool 45 minutes and remove sides of pan. Can be served warm or cold.
Gluten-free Option:
- Place filling in porcelain ramekins. Top with apple slices and cinnamon. Bake at 350 degrees for 12 minutes.
Optional Toppings:
- Option 1: Drizzle with your favorite liqueur (such as Amaretto).
- Option 2: Top with a small portion of ice cream (check for FfL-ingredients).
Recipe Notes
Gluten-free: Use gluten-free ingredients, if necessary. If you can't find gluten-free graham cracker crumbs, bake crustless in porcelain ramekins.
